Output 66cffec302033dab5aa04dc01d059169342082e12331b0202412fbfe43126b50:1

value
94870203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11b821189791633eba4cdfde2e504ed5a6eea2d8 OP_EQUALVERIFY OP_CHECKSIG
address
12ch4nhS3DefxgoMWkxn4EcPnJDdQSG1n8
transaction
66cffec302033dab5aa04dc01d059169342082e12331b0202412fbfe43126b50
spent
true